Understanding the memorandum of understanding (MoU)
A memorandum of understanding (MoU) serves as a vital document in formalizing an agreement between two or more parties. Unlike a contract, which is legally binding, an MoU often outlines the intention and terms of a collaborative relationship without the strict enforceability that contracts have. This flexibility makes MoUs particularly attractive for negotiations, agreements on preliminary terms, and establishing mutual understanding between parties.
While an MoU is not a legally binding document, it does carry legal significance, as it reflects the parties' commitment to adhere to the outlined principles and mutual understanding. The distinction between a memorandum of understanding and a memorandum of agreement (MoA) lies primarily in the level of commitment. An MoA usually entails more formal, legally enforceable obligations whereas an MoU signifies a preliminary agreement to work together.
Importance of an MoU in collaborative relationships
Opting for a memorandum of understanding in collaborative partnerships helps ensure that all parties are on the same page. MoUs serve to articulate expectations, responsibilities, and goals, thereby helping to prevent misunderstandings during the collaboration. Whether for business ventures, academic collaborations, or community projects, MoUs facilitate streamlined communication and clarify the path toward shared objectives.
Due to their flexible nature, MoUs can evolve with the collaborative relationship. As circumstances change, the MoU can be updated, reflecting the revised agreements among the parties. This adaptability is why organizations and teams increasingly choose to incorporate MoUs into their collaborative strategies, providing a foundation for growth and partnership.
When to use a memorandum of understanding
Identifying the right situations for drafting an MoU is crucial for effective collaboration. An MoU is particularly valuable in scenarios such as joint ventures, research partnerships, or any collaborative projects involving multiple stakeholders. When organizations seek to clarify their collaboration, detailing the frameworks and expectations will enhance both performance and accountability.
Drafting an MoU provides numerous benefits, including clear expectations regarding roles, timelines, and deliverables. By adopting this structured approach, all parties remain aligned and focused on achieving common goals. This clarity can significantly reduce the potential for conflict, making the collaborative process smoother and more effective.
